I saw a distant winter photo of the Fargo, ND rail station online, with two passenger cars spotted on a Fargo stub track with a caboose. Are there any details of what type of cars they are? Are they part of a train display?

They must be part of a display since they are on a track not connected to the main line. This is at the former NP station, not the former GN station used by Amtrak. Ironically, the caboose in the display is painted with a GN goat logo.
